HomeTechnology5 Tips For Building...

5 Tips For Building A Trustworthy ML Model

Data is said to be crucial in today’s highly modern world. All forms of data are significant in forming sets that are used and processed by machines that make artificial intelligence (AI) possible. 

It’s said that the way people and device systems interact with data is changing rapidly. Electronic gadgets are now capable of executing decisions thanks to the availability of a wide range of data – the process is called machine learning (ML). Devices use ML models to make them smarter and more versatile in decision making. Experts believe that the performance of an AI-capable device depends on the ML model it’s based on. 

As machine learning models become more sophisticated, it’s important to remember that not all are created equal. Some models are far more trustworthy than others.

Tips to keep in mind when building a reliable ML Model

1. Consider How The Model Will Be Used

When building any machine learning (ML) model, it’s essential to consider how the model will be used. A model may be accurate and unbiased, but if it isn’t used correctly, it can still cause harm.

For example, an ML model designed to predict creditworthiness may be biased against certain groups of people if it isn’t correctly validated. Similarly, a model used to approve or deny loans automatically could also be biased if it isn’t thoroughly tested. Therefore, it’s essential to consider how the ML model will be used before deploying it.

In addition to considering how the ML model will be used, it’s also important to think about AI governance. This refers to ensuring that AI systems are ethically sound and compliant with laws and regulations. 

With the rapid development of ML and AI technologies, there has been an increased focus on governance. This is because as AI systems become more complicated and powerful, they have the potential to impact more aspects of people’s lives. For example, autonomous vehicles are becoming increasingly common, and as such, there’s a need to ensure that these tech advancements are safe and reliable.

2. Collect Your Data In A Way That Is Representative Of The Real World

While building any model, the data used to train the model must represent the real world. This is because a model’s purpose is to generalize from the data it has seen and make predictions on unseen data. If the training data doesn’t represent the real world, then the model will not be able to generalize well and will not perform well on unseen data.

There are many ways to collect data in a way that isn’t representative of the real world. For example, if a dataset only contains data from a specific geographic region with completely different cultures, demographics, history, and the like, it’ll not represent the global population. 

Therefore, you must ensure that data is collected to represent the real world to build an effective machine learning model.

3. Ensure That The Quality Of Data Is Clean And Free Of Errors

ML has made the world a better place to live in many ways. It changed the world for the better, and one way it does it is through its ability to help users make better decisions by analyzing large amounts of data. Nonetheless, ML is only as perfect as the data feeding it. If the data is inaccurate or full of errors, the ML model will be too.

Hence, ensuring that the data used to train the ML models is clean and free of errors is essential. Data can be cleaned in several ways, such as removing outliers or imputing missing values.

In addition to ensuring that the data is clean, it’s also essential to verify that it is accurate. This can be achieved by checking for inconsistencies and verifying sources. By taking these steps, you can ensure that your machine learning model is only as good as the data it is based on.

Check out: Future Application of AI and ML in the Healthcare Sector

4. Choose An Appropriate Machine Learning Algorithm

There are many different machine learning algorithms, each with its strengths and weaknesses. Consequently, it’s essential to choose an appropriate algorithm for the task.

Case in point, if you’re building a model to classify images, you’d need to use a different algorithm than if you were building a model to predict the price of a stock.

Plus, it’s non-negotiable to consider the trade-offs between different algorithms. For instance, some algorithms are more accurate but require more data, while others are less accurate but can be trained on fewer data.

5. Go For A Simple Model

If you want to create and maintain an effective ML model, you should go for a simpler model. More specifically, you want to avoid using too many features, which can lead to overfitting. Overfitting hampers the maximum performance of a specific ML.

You want to ensure that your machine learning model is also understandable and interpretable. If the model you’ve produced isn’t understandable, it may be challenging to trust and work with. 

Final Word

The abovementioned are just a few vital tips on building trustworthy ML models. By following them, you can ensure that your machine learning model is effective and reliable. Yet remember that building an effective machine learning model is a complex process, and the insights mentioned above are just a starting point. If you want to learn more about how ML and AI can benefit you, consider taking an online course or reading a book on the subject.

Check out: Machine Learning Is Effecting the Future Of Software Testing

Most Popular

More from Author

Why Choose Python for Your Next Software Project?

Python is an immensely flexible programming language with numerous uses. It's...

Beyond the Syntax: Elevate Your Code with Expert Programming Assignment Help

There are three things every student must master – reading, writing,...

Security and Compliance Importance in Healthcare Software Development

Security and compliance are not mere checkboxes in healthcare software development;...

Custom Insurance Software Development: Full Guide 2024

The security sector has changed as a result of technology. It...

Read Now

Maximizing Efficiency and Value through LMS Consulting Services

In the evolving landscape of educational technology, Learning Management Systems (LMS) have become a cornerstone for delivering effective training and education. However, selecting the right LMS can be a daunting task, filled with complexities and significant financial implications. This is where LMS consulting services play a pivotal role. Today with...

Tablets, Computers, and Personal Devices Revolutionize Smart Factories

In the dynamic landscape of Industry 4.0, the convergence of technology and manufacturing has given rise to the concept of smart factories. Central to this transformation are tablets and personal devices, which have become indispensable tools in the hands of industrial professionals. This article explores the significant...

DevOps Tech Debt Trimming: Cost Optimization with Kubernetes

Continuous reassessment and restructuring are essential for achieving pivotal and evolutionary advantages, particularly in the context of modern DevOps. The demand for intelligent and distributed solutions is continually rising through the unification of ops methodologies. The combination of DevOps and MLOps has paved the way for limitless...

Emerging Trends in Database Support: AI, Machine Learning, and Predictive Maintenance

As organizations navigate the evolving landscape of database management, the integration of artificial intelligence (AI), machine learning (ML), and predictive maintenance is ushering in a new era of efficiency and proactive problem-solving. This article explores the emerging trends in database support, shedding light on how the fusion...

Autonomous Mobile Robots: A Complete Guide to AMR Robotics

Hauling items from place to place may not have been the dramatic robot revolution we envisioned in our childhood – it may seem a little too simple, too regular, not quite cool enough. However, in actuality, it’s tasks with these exact qualities – tedious, repetitive, time-intensive –...

Demystifying Service Performance Tests: A Comprehensive Guide Featuring 4 Industry Giants

In the fast-paced world of technology, ensuring the optimal performance of services is paramount for businesses. Service performance tests play a crucial role in achieving this goal, providing valuable insights into the reliability and efficiency of systems. In this comprehensive guide, we will demystify service performance tests,...

How to Choose a Managed IT Service Provider for Your Business

Your IT department is one of your business's most strategic areas. Yes, it eats up a lot of your budget, but without it, your organization would remain obscure. Without IT services, you could not send or receive emails. You couldn't manage your business content (website) or employee...

The Malaysian Business Guide to ERP: Selecting the Best System for Your Needs

Enterprise Resource Planning (ERP) system have become a cornerstone for driving efficiency and innovation. Particularly in Malaysia, with its vibrant economy and diverse business landscape, the right ERP system can be a game-changer. This guide aims to steer Malaysian businesses through the maze of selecting the most...

Why is a SaaS’s Centralization Useful?

SaaS platforms are being adopted at an ever-increasing rate by businesses across a broad range of industries and sectors. While the SaaS model can offer some fantastic benefits, it is a different way of working that can require some adjustment time. Part of the appeal of using SaaS...

The Vital Role of MDM Solutions in Managing Shared Android Devices in Healthcare

The healthcare sector has been digitalized with the latest digital gadgets to streamline patient appointment scheduling, diagnosis process, and treatments. These devices are highly alarming for every healthcare center because some medical apps are very important in providing aid to patients in an emergency. So, it is...

Hiring the Best of the Best: Main Skills Unreal Engine Developers Must Have

Why does finding the right Unreal Engine developer look like a search for a needle in a haystack? The demand for these specialists has skyrocketed, yet the supply often falls short. This disparity creates a challenging landscape for companies that seek to hire Unreal Engine developers. To find...

Elevating Content Creation: AI Video Editing Mastery Sets the Standard

In the fast-paced realm of digital content creation, staying ahead of the curve is not just a preference; it's a necessity. As businesses strive for compelling visual narratives, the integration of Artificial Intelligence (AI) in video editing has emerged as a game-changer. This article delves into the...